Proocam 49mm To 58mm Step-up Ring

The Raynox DCR-250 clip-on lens that I own, it can only be mounted onto a camera that has lens thread size of between 52mm and 67mm.

My Canon 50mm f/1.8 STM lens on my Canon EOS 800d/T7i though, only has a thread size of 49mm.

Proocam Step-up Ring 49mm To 58mm

So how am I going to mount my Raynox clip-on lens onto my Canon 50mm lens? Get myself a step-up ring of course. And that is exactly what I did 2 months ago - I bought myself a Proocam 49mm to 58mm step-up ring. A Proocam by the way since I am happy with my last purchase for my point-and-shoot camera. The price too is quite reasonable at RM20 since they were having a promotion at that time.

Proocam Step-up Ring Mounted On My Canon 50mm f/1.8 STM Lens

Pretty good and I am satisfied with this metal step-up ring. Quite solidly build. Mounting it on the lens was easy - I didn't encounter any problems. And more importantly, my Raynox clips on nicely.

So now I can get really close on my close-ups and fill the frame with my tiny still-life shots. Pictures like this for example (beads are 5mm in size, by the way):
